Abstract:
The stem segments and tender leaves which were current-year branches of Prunus persica (L.) Batsch were used as explants.Using the single factor design,the effects of different disinfection methods on the inoculated of two explants contamination rate and callus formation rate,and the rate of callus formation under different hormone types and concentration ratio were studied,in order to lay a foundation for the regeneration system and genetic transformation of P.persica.The results showed that the optimal surface disinfection of the stem segments of P.persica was 75% alcohol 30 seconds+2.5% NaClO 10 minutes;the optimum medium for stem segments was MS + 6-BA 1.0 mg?L-1+IBA 0.5 mg?L-1+GA3 0.5 mg ?L-1.And the optimal surface disinfection of the tender leaves of P.persica was 75% alcohol 30 seconds+2.5% NaClO 6 minutes+0.5% NaClO 10 minutes;the optimum medium for tender leaves was 1/2MS+TDZ 1.5 mg?L-1+NAA 0.1 mg?L-1.In this study,the regeneration system from stem segments and leaves of P.persica was established,which laid the foundation for the genetic transformation of peach.
